Smart Contract DeFi Security Ignite_ Ensuring Trust in the Digital Frontier
Smart Contract DeFi Security Ignite: Understanding the Basics and the Risks
Welcome to the fascinating world of decentralized finance (DeFi), where traditional financial systems meet the cutting-edge technology of blockchain. At its core, DeFi is built on smart contracts—self-executing contracts with the terms of the agreement directly written into code. These contracts automate and enforce the rules of financial transactions, offering a transparent and trustless environment. But with great power comes great responsibility, especially when it comes to security.
The Core of DeFi: Smart Contracts
Smart contracts have revolutionized the way we think about transactions and agreements. They operate on blockchain networks like Ethereum, automatically executing trades, loans, and other financial activities without the need for intermediaries. This decentralization promises a more inclusive financial system where anyone with an internet connection can participate.
However, the very nature of smart contracts—immutable and transparent—means any flaw can have far-reaching consequences. Once deployed, they cannot be altered, making security paramount. A single line of code with a vulnerability can lead to significant financial losses, potentially compromising millions of dollars.
The Risks and Vulnerabilities
Smart contracts are not immune to vulnerabilities. Some of the most common risks include:
Logic Errors: These occur when the code does not perform as intended. A simple typo or logic flaw can lead to catastrophic failures. For instance, a logic error in a lending protocol might allow users to borrow more than they should, potentially leading to a liquidity crisis.
Reentrancy Attacks: This is a classic exploit where an attacker calls a function in a smart contract repeatedly, causing the contract to execute the attacker's code multiple times before completing its own execution. The famous DAO hack in 2016 was a result of such an attack, draining millions of dollars from the platform.
Front-Running: This occurs when a malicious actor observes a transaction about to be mined and crafts a similar transaction with a higher gas fee to have it prioritized. It’s a race to the blockchain, where the fastest gets the reward at the expense of the original transaction.
Flash Loans: These are uncollateralized loans in DeFi that must be repaid in a single transaction. If the borrower fails to repay, they lose their entire crypto holdings. However, if used maliciously, flash loans can be exploited to manipulate prices or execute other fraudulent activities.
The Human Factor
While technical vulnerabilities are a significant concern, the human factor cannot be ignored. Developers, auditors, and users all play crucial roles in the security ecosystem. Mistakes in coding, oversight during audits, and even social engineering attacks can all lead to security breaches.
Best Practices for Smart Contract Security
To navigate the risks inherent in smart contracts, the DeFi community has developed several best practices:
Code Reviews: Just like in software development, peer reviews are crucial. Multiple sets of eyes can catch errors that a single developer might miss.
Automated Testing: Comprehensive testing frameworks like Truffle and Hardhat can help identify vulnerabilities early in the development process.
Formal Verification: This technique uses mathematical proofs to ensure that the code adheres to its specifications. While resource-intensive, it offers a high level of assurance.
Audits by Third Parties: Professional security audits by reputable firms can uncover vulnerabilities that internal teams might miss. Auditing firms like CertiK, Trail of Bits, and Quantstamp bring expertise and objectivity to the table.
Bug Bounty Programs: Incentivizing security researchers to find and report vulnerabilities can lead to early detection and resolution of flaws.
Conclusion to Part 1
The DeFi landscape is evolving rapidly, with smart contracts at its heart. While the technology holds immense promise for a more inclusive financial system, it also presents unique security challenges. Understanding the risks and implementing best practices is crucial for safeguarding this digital frontier. In the next part, we'll delve deeper into innovative solutions and the future of DeFi security.
Smart Contract DeFi Security Ignite: Innovations and the Future
Building on the foundation laid in the first part, we now turn our attention to the innovations shaping the future of DeFi security and how they might mitigate the risks we've discussed.
Innovative Solutions
Zero Knowledge Proofs (ZKPs): ZKPs allow one party to prove to another that a certain statement is true, without revealing any additional information. This technology can be used to verify transactions and smart contract executions without exposing sensitive data, adding a layer of privacy and security.
Multi-Party Computation (MPC): MPC allows multiple parties to jointly compute a function over their inputs while keeping those inputs private. This can enhance security in decentralized applications by distributing the computation and reducing the risk of a single point of failure.
Secure Enclaves: These are isolated environments where sensitive computations can take place without exposing the underlying blockchain network. This can be particularly useful for DeFi protocols that handle large sums of money.
Decentralized Identity Verification: As DeFi platforms grow, so does the need for secure identity verification. Decentralized identity solutions can ensure that users are who they claim to be without relying on centralized authorities, reducing the risk of fraud.
Emerging Technologies
Sidechains and Layer 2 Solutions: These technologies create parallel layers to the main blockchain, reducing congestion and increasing transaction speed. By offloading transactions from the main chain, they can also enhance the security and scalability of DeFi protocols.
Interoperability Protocols: As DeFi ecosystems grow, the ability to interact seamlessly across different blockchains becomes crucial. Protocols like Polkadot and Cosmos are working to create a more connected web of blockchains, but they also introduce new security considerations that need to be addressed.
Quantum-Resistant Algorithms: With the advent of quantum computing, traditional cryptographic algorithms may become vulnerable. Research is underway to develop quantum-resistant algorithms that can secure smart contracts against future threats.
The Role of Decentralized Governance
Decentralized governance models are emerging as vital components of DeFi security. These models involve community members in decision-making processes, ensuring that security updates and protocol changes reflect the consensus of the community. Governance tokens allow holders to vote on critical issues, fostering a sense of ownership and responsibility.
Case Studies and Success Stories
Compound Protocol: Compound has implemented rigorous security measures, including regular audits and bug bounty programs. Their proactive approach has helped them maintain trust and stability in a highly volatile environment.
Uniswap: Uniswap’s governance model allows users to propose and vote on changes to the protocol, ensuring that security enhancements are community-driven. This transparency and inclusivity have bolstered user confidence.
Aave: Aave employs a multi-pronged security strategy, including automated smart contract monitoring, regular audits, and a bug bounty program. Their proactive stance has helped them identify and mitigate potential threats swiftly.
Looking Ahead: The Future of DeFi Security
The future of DeFi security is poised for significant advancements. As the ecosystem matures, we can expect to see:
Increased Adoption of Advanced Cryptographic Techniques: The integration of advanced cryptographic methods like ZKPs and MPC will enhance privacy and security.
Enhanced Regulatory Compliance: As DeFi gains mainstream acceptance, regulatory frameworks will evolve to address security and compliance concerns, fostering a more secure and trustworthy environment.
Greater Interoperability and Collaboration: As different blockchains and DeFi platforms find ways to work together, we’ll see more robust security protocols that can span multiple networks.
Evolving Developer Tools: Tools and frameworks that aid in secure smart contract development will continue to evolve, making it easier for developers to build secure applications.
Conclusion
The journey of smart contract DeFi security is far from over. It's a dynamic and evolving field that requires continuous vigilance, innovation, and collaboration. By embracing best practices, leveraging cutting-edge technologies, and fostering a culture of security and transparency, the DeFi community can build a robust and resilient financial ecosystem.
As we stand on the cusp of a new era in finance, the principles of smart contract DeFi security will guide us toward a future where trust and innovation go hand in hand.
ZK P2P Finance Edge Win: The Dawn of a Decentralized Revolution
In the ever-evolving world of finance, the emergence of ZK P2P (Zero-Knowledge Peer-to-Peer) finance is nothing short of revolutionary. This innovative paradigm merges the cutting-edge technology of zero-knowledge proofs with the time-honored tradition of peer-to-peer lending, creating a synergy that promises to redefine how we think about financial transactions.
The Essence of ZK Technology
At the core of ZK P2P finance lies the groundbreaking concept of zero-knowledge proofs. This cryptographic innovation allows one party to prove to another that a certain statement is true without revealing any additional information. In simpler terms, it’s like proving that you know a secret without actually disclosing what that secret is. This principle ensures that the identities and financial details of participants remain private, fostering a secure and trustworthy environment.
Peer-to-Peer Lending: A Timeless Tradition
Peer-to-peer lending, a concept that has been around for decades, involves individuals lending money directly to each other without the involvement of traditional financial intermediaries like banks. The idea has always been about creating direct connections and fostering trust between lenders and borrowers. However, it has often been hampered by issues of transparency, security, and efficiency.
The Intersection: ZK P2P Finance
Enter ZK P2P finance, where the best of both worlds comes together. By integrating zero-knowledge proofs into peer-to-peer lending platforms, this new frontier not only preserves the direct, personal nature of lending but also enhances it with unparalleled security and transparency. Here’s how:
Enhanced Security and Privacy
One of the most significant advantages of ZK P2P finance is the robust security it provides. With zero-knowledge proofs, sensitive information such as identities, financial histories, and personal details are safeguarded. This reduces the risk of fraud and data breaches, providing users with a sense of security they’ve never had before in peer-to-peer lending.
Increased Transparency
Transparency has always been a challenge in traditional P2P lending, but ZK technology offers a solution. By using cryptographic proofs, lenders and borrowers can verify the authenticity of transactions without revealing any confidential information. This ensures that every transaction is legitimate and builds a foundation of trust within the network.
Efficiency and Scalability
Blockchain technology, the backbone of ZK P2P finance, offers a decentralized, transparent ledger that is both efficient and scalable. Transactions are processed quickly and can handle a high volume of requests without compromising speed or security. This scalability means that more people can participate in the lending process, democratizing access to financial services.
Global Accessibility
One of the most exciting aspects of ZK P2P finance is its global accessibility. With the internet as the medium, individuals from all corners of the globe can connect, lend, and borrow without geographical limitations. This opens up a world of opportunities for underserved communities and individuals who may not have access to traditional banking systems.
Real-World Applications
The potential applications of ZK P2P finance are vast and varied. Here are a few examples that highlight its transformative power:
Micro-Lending for Underserved Populations: Small loans can be provided to individuals in remote areas who lack access to traditional banking, fostering economic growth and development.
Crowdfunding: Projects and startups can receive funding directly from a global pool of investors, bypassing traditional funding hurdles.
Real Estate Financing: Individuals looking to buy property can secure loans from a diverse group of lenders, with the added security of zero-knowledge proofs ensuring that all parties are protected.
Challenges and Future Prospects
While the potential of ZK P2P finance is immense, it is not without challenges. The technology is still evolving, and there are regulatory, technical, and educational hurdles to overcome. However, the trajectory is clear – as advancements in blockchain and zero-knowledge proofs continue, the barriers are likely to diminish, paving the way for a more inclusive and secure financial ecosystem.
Conclusion
ZK P2P finance represents a significant leap forward in the world of decentralized lending. By combining the best aspects of zero-knowledge proofs and peer-to-peer lending, it offers a secure, transparent, and efficient platform for global financial transactions. As this innovative field continues to develop, it promises to unlock new opportunities and reshape the future of finance in profound ways.
Stay tuned for Part 2, where we will delve deeper into the technical intricacies and future trends of ZK P2P finance, exploring how this paradigm shift is poised to transform the financial landscape.
Unraveling the Technical Tapestry: The Future of ZK P2P Finance
In Part 1, we explored the revolutionary fusion of zero-knowledge proofs and peer-to-peer lending, setting the stage for a new era in decentralized finance. Now, let’s dive deeper into the technical intricacies and future trends that are shaping the trajectory of ZK P2P finance.
Technical Underpinnings of ZK P2P Finance
To truly grasp the potential of ZK P2P finance, we need to understand the technical backbone that supports it. The integration of zero-knowledge proofs into peer-to-peer lending platforms hinges on several advanced technologies:
Zero-Knowledge Proofs
At the heart of ZK P2P finance are zero-knowledge proofs (ZKPs). These cryptographic proofs enable one party to prove to another that a statement is true without revealing any additional information. Here’s how it works in the context of P2P lending:
Prover and Verifier: In a typical ZKP scenario, the prover generates a proof that they know certain information (e.g., a borrower’s creditworthiness) without revealing the information itself. The verifier then checks the proof to ensure its validity without gaining any insight into the underlying data.
Example: A borrower can prove they have a good credit score without disclosing their full credit report. This ensures privacy while allowing lenders to make informed decisions.
Blockchain Technology
Blockchain technology provides the decentralized, transparent ledger that underpins ZK P2P finance. Key aspects include:
Decentralization: Transactions are recorded on a decentralized ledger, reducing the risk of single points of failure and increasing security. Transparency: All transactions are visible on the blockchain, ensuring that all parties can verify the legitimacy of transactions without revealing sensitive information. Immutability: Once a transaction is recorded, it cannot be altered, ensuring the integrity of the financial records.
Smart Contracts
Smart contracts automate the lending process, enforcing the terms of loans and repayments without the need for intermediaries. They are self-executing contracts with the terms directly written into code. In ZK P2P finance, smart contracts can:
Automate Verification: Automatically verify the authenticity of zero-knowledge proofs, ensuring that all parties meet the agreed-upon conditions. Enforce Terms: Automatically execute repayments and interest calculations, reducing the need for manual intervention.
Future Trends and Innovations
The future of ZK P2P finance is bright, with several trends and innovations poised to further enhance its capabilities:
Interoperability
As the ecosystem grows, interoperability between different blockchain networks will become crucial. This will allow users to seamlessly connect and transact across various platforms, enhancing the global reach and usability of ZK P2P finance.
Regulatory Adaptation
While regulatory challenges remain, ongoing dialogue between technologists, regulators, and financial institutions will likely lead to frameworks that accommodate the unique aspects of ZK P2P finance. This will help ensure that the technology can thrive within legal boundaries.
Enhanced User Experience
Future developments will focus on making the ZK P2P finance experience more user-friendly. This includes intuitive interfaces, simplified onboarding processes, and educational resources to help users understand and trust the technology.
Scalability Solutions
Scalability remains a critical challenge for blockchain technology. Innovations like sharding, layer-2 solutions, and improved consensus mechanisms will be crucial in ensuring that ZK P2P finance can handle a high volume of transactions efficiently.
Security Enhancements
Continuous improvements in cryptographic techniques will bolster the security of ZK P2P finance. This includes the development of more robust zero-knowledge proofs and advanced encryption methods to protect user data and financial transactions.
Real-World Applications and Case Studies
To illustrate the practical impact of ZK P2P finance, let’s explore some real-world applications and case studies:
Case Study 1: Micro-Lending for Underserved Communities
A micro-lending platform leveraging ZK P2P finance enabled small loans to individuals in remote areas of Africa. By using zero-knowledge proofs, borrowers’ identities and financial histories were kept private, reducing the risk of fraud and increasing trust among lenders. This initiative empowered local entrepreneurs, fostering economic growth in underserved communities.
Case Study 2: Crowdfunding for Innovative Startups
A startup focused on renewable energy solutions used ZK P2P finance to raise funds from a diverse group of investors. The platform’继续介绍这些实际应用和未来趋势将帮助我们更深入地理解 ZK P2P 金融的潜力和实现方式。
Case Study 3: Real Estate Financing
一家房地产平台利用 ZK P2P 金融为希望购房的个人提供贷款。借助零知识证明,贷款申请人的身份和财务状况得以保密,从而减少了欺诈风险并增强了贷款人的信任。这一举措使得更多人有机会参与到房地产市场中,促进了房地产行业的发展。
Future Innovations
AI Integration
人工智能(AI)的整合将进一步提升 ZK P2P 金融的效率和智能化。AI 可以用于风险评估、市场分析和智能合约执行,使得整个过程更加自动化和精确。
DeFi Integration
去中心化金融(DeFi)和 ZK P2P 金融的结合将带来更多创新的金融产品和服务。例如,借助 DeFi,借款人可以获得更灵活的借贷条件,而贷款人则能够在不同的金融产品中获得更高的回报。
Enhanced Privacy and Security
随着隐私和安全需求的增加,未来的 ZK P2P 金融平台将会采用更先进的隐私保护技术,如多重签名和零知识证明的新算法,以进一步保护用户的数据和交易。
Global Collaboration
全球范围内的合作将是推动 ZK P2P 金融发展的关键因素。跨国界的合作将带来更多的资源和技术支持,促进更广泛的应用和接受。
Conclusion
ZK P2P 金融的未来充满了无限的可能性。通过不断的技术创新和全球合作,这一领域将会不断发展,为全球金融市场带来更多的机会和更高的效率。无论是在微贷、众筹还是房地产融资等领域,ZK P2P 金融都展示了其巨大的潜力,并且有望成为未来金融生态系统的重要组成部分。
我们期待着这一革命性的金融模式在更多领域中的广泛应用,并看到它如何改变我们对传统金融服务的认知和期待。
Best NFT Projects with Real Utility_ Transforming Digital Ownership
Unlock Your Financial Future The Allure of Passive Crypto Earnings